Lecture: Worlds Turned Upside Down: The Trench Slaughter of World War I and the Assault on Europe's Civilizing Mission

World War I was a trying time for not only the United States, but the entire world and if you are looking for a way to learn more about it, then you need to attend the Lecture: Worlds Turned Upside Down: The Trench Slaughter of World War I and the Assault on Europe's Civilizing Mission at the College of William and Mary, located at 1779 Massachusettes NW in Washington, DC 20036.

This is a lecture that will take you right into the trials and turmoils of WWI, which was a war that not only changed the face of war, but of living itself because of the different technologies that were introduced. The lecture will focus on the trench fighting of the war along with the impact that it had on the different countries in Europe where the war took place.
